Today on The Message of The Cross, Evangelist Jimmy Swaggart and the panel discuss the salvation of the Israelites; seeing the glad tidings of the Israelites at the end of Exodus chapter four and then, by the end of chapter five, they are struggling against the power of Satan that wants to keep their soul in bondage. Brother Swaggart reminds us, we must stand on the promises of God; the Cross is the only thing standing between man and the eternal darkness of hell. The believer must anchor their faith in the Cross of Christ as their sole foundation; then and only then, the power of the Holy Spirit will bring deliverance and victory over sin given at salvation, and then when the believer asks for the baptism of the Holy Spirit, as a second subsequent work, more power will be bestowed for service and ministry. Brother Larson explains Acts one looking at the power of the Holy Spirit and the "growing and going” that is to take place in a believer’s life.
